Is there an easy way to make diagonal paths? im having a hard time lining flowers and trees up right.
 
My town has two diagonal paths. Not sure what tips I can give you.
 
I think that making diagonal paths is just a matter of finding a pattern that has a diagonal look to it (for example, if it's bricks, instead of them being lined horizontally, they'd be lined diagonally) and then placing them this way like laying a regular path except you make the diagonal patterns line up by skipping squares that way.

Take my suggestion: Don't make diagonal paths.

They don't look right in the game and they are hard to pull off. You can go online and download some QR codes of already made diagonal paths if you really want to. It's just hard to make these type of paths blend correctly. If you can pull it off, kudos to you.

I have to agree with WonderK here. Diagonal paths are a pain because you need decent grass design to match your town's grass.
